Plateau Gov presents 2018 145billion budget of Rescue and Consolidation – Giwa Alex, jos.

The Plateau state Governor RT. Hon Bako Lalong has present a budget estimate of 145 Billion Naira before the state grouse of assembly for the 2018 fiscal year.

The budget tagged “BUDGET OF RESCUE AND CONSOLIDATION”, when pass by the maker according to Governor Lalong shall help in consolidating on the gains and achievements of the administration since the beginning of our Rescue Mission.

The Budget has a total size of One Hundred and Forty-Five Billion, Four Hundred and Eighty-Eight Million, Sixty-Six Thousand, Three Hundred and Fifty-Two Naira (N145,488,066,352.00) only.

The Governor said the increase in the 2018 estimated budget is largely due to increase in certain Recurrent Expenditures and the fact that the Country is going out of recession and the hope that economy is getting better; thereby improving the Internally Generated Revenue (IGR) potentials of the State.

He however pointed out that the fiscal budget for 2018 had a deficit of the sum of Thirty Four Billion, Three Hundred and Sixty-One Million, Five Hundred and One Thousand, Two Hundred and Fifty-Nine Naira (N34,361,501,259.00) representing 23.62% of the budget size. The deficit is to finance the expenditure side of the estimate and will be draw from both internal sources if the need arises during the implementation of the budget.

He reiterated his administration commitment to improved the fallen standard of education in the state.

“This administration is fully committed to improving the fallen standard of education in the State. Therefore, the sum of Eleven Billion, Seven Hundred and Forty-Four Million, Seven Hundred and Fifty Four Thousand, Six Hundred and Seven Naira. (N11,744,754,607.00) only, representing 16.86% of the capital budget for this purpose, he said.

Agriculture is a sector that desires serious attention as a major provider of employment. Governments at all levels are shifting attention to turn-around the economy of Nigeria through this sector and Plateau State cannot be left out. In this budget, the sum of Three Billion, Six Hundred and Thirty-One Million, Eight Hundred and Fifty Thousand Naira (N3,631,850,000.00) only is estimated for Agricultural Programmes, representing 5.21 percent of the estimate. Major projects and programmes include subsidy on Fertilizer, Tractorization, General Livestock Development and Special Intervention Programme in Agriculture, are projects also included in this budget.

Establishment and Management of Ranches has been introduced in the proposed budget. This will curb the activities of cattle owners and Herdsmen or Rearers, which is the major cause of crises in the State and Nation at Plateau Radio Television.
The estimate for the Health sub-sector is Four Billion, Three Hundred and Fifty-Five Million, Three Hundred and Fifty Four Thousand, Eight Hundred and Forty-One Naira (N4,355,354,841.00) representing 6.25 percent of the capital budget.

The Sum of Three Billion Five Hundred and Two Million, Eight Hundred Thousand Naira (N3,502,800,000.00) only is estimated for Water, Energy and Sanitation in the budget, representing 5.03 percent. In realization of the importance of Water and Energy to human existence, Government in the past have sunk a lot of resources towards its Improvement.

On tourism and hospitality,Governor Lalong said the government is
making concerted efforts to harness all the tourism potentials in the State. To this end, the sum of Three Hundred and Fifty-Four Million, Nine Hundred Thousand Naira (N354,900,000.00) only is allocated in the budget.

” This administration will continue to give our Women and Youth a prime place to participate actively in the governance process. To achieve this, the sum of Nine Hundred and Fifty-Two Million, Two Hundred Thousand Naira (N952,200,000.00) only is allocated for their Programs.

One Billion Forty-Three Million One Hundred and Ninety-seven Thousand, Nine Hundred and Twenty Seven Naira(N1,043,197,927.00) only for the preservation of environment and Mineral Resources Development

The judiciary will also be given a desired attention as the High Court Complex under construction will be completed during the year, while other courts in dilapidated conditions will be renovated for the effective dissemination of Justice in the state.

For effective information dissemination and management, the sum of One Billion, Three Hundred and Seventy-Nine Million, Nine Hundred and Twenty Eight Thousand, Thirteen Naira (N1,379,928,013.00) only is estimated in the budget representing 1.98 percent. This amount is for the provision of facilities, equipment and renovation of offices at Plateau.

On his speech ,the speaker Hon. Peter Azi assured the Governor ,the law maker’s commitment to do justice to the appropriation bill by ensuring the budget is pass without delay.
